Package: phaRmacyForecasting
Title: Putting the R in pharmacy- a Shiny application to make forecasts
of medication use in pharmacies in Nottinghamshire Healthcare NHS Trust
Version: 0.2.1
Authors@R: person('Chris', 'Beeley', email = '[email protected]', role = c('cre', 'aut'))
Description: This is a Shiny application which allows users to make predictions
on the volumes of drugs issued from Nottinghamshire Healthcare pharmacies. A variety
of forecasting models are used, and options are provided to tweak the forecast to
improve model fit
